When was TH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M founded?
TH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M was officially incorporated on 24 July 2007 and is registered under company number 06322344.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.
What type of company is TH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M?
PRI/LBG/NSC (Private, Limited by guarantee, no share capital, use of 'Limited' exemption). This classification indicates the legal structure of the company, which determines the way it is governed, its liability, and regulatory obligations.
What is the current status of TH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M?
TH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M's current status is Active. The company status indicates whether it is actively trading, dormant, or has been dissolved. Maintaining an active status is essential for legally conducting business, filing accounts, and maintaining credibility with partners and lenders.
What does TH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M do?
TH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M operates in the following sector: 91020 - Museums activities. This provides insight into the company's primary business activity and industry focus.
What is TH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M's registered address?
The registered office address of TH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M is WHITE HORSE YARD, 163-165 WATLING STREET, TOWCESTER, UNITED KINGDOM, NN12 6BU. This is the official address filed with Companies House for legal and statutory correspondence.
Is TH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M financially stable?
The most recent accounts for TH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M were made up to 30 September 2024, filed as TOTAL EXEMPTION FULL. Next accounts are due by 30 September 2026.
Does TH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M have any charges or mortgages?
THE TOWCESTER MUSEUM has 3 registered charges, of which 1 is outstanding, 2 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
